Android phones invade the world
Google activates 160,000 a day

Google is activating 160,000 Android-OS phones a day - up from 100,000 a day in the third week of May.
Android apps are also growing at a lick, with about 65,000 available, compared with 50,000 a month ago.
The figures come from Google chief exec Eric Schmidt, in an exclusive interview with The Guardian.
